发明名称 Method for Transitioning Between Incompatible Olefin Polymerization Catalyst Systems
摘要 A method for transitioning from a Ziegler-Natta to a Phillips catalyst system for the olefin polymerization reaction in one reactor, preferably a gas phase reactor, is described. The method comprises the steps of a) discontinuing a first olefin polymerization reaction performed in the presence of the Ziegler-Natta catalyst system; b) performing a second olefin polymerization reaction in the presence of a further catalyst system comprising catalyst components (A) and (B) producing, respectively, a first and a second polyolefin fraction, wherein the Mw of the first polyolefin fraction is less than the Mw of the second polyolefin fraction and the initial activity of catalyst component (A) exceeds the initial activity of catalyst component (B); and c) performing a third olefin polymerization reaction the presence of the Phillips catalyst system. Thanks to this method, there is no need to empty the reactor after each olefin polymerization reaction, and the transitioning time needed to attain the desired quality of the polyolefin obtained in each olefin polymerization reaction subsequent to the first one is sufficiently short to permit a quick and reliable change of production.
